Project Overview
The University Avenue Complete Streets project was previously known as the University Bikeway project. We renamed it to more accurately reflect the work that we are doing. The project will run along University Avenue between Estrella Avenue and 69th Street and along Estrella Avenue between University and Orange avenues, providing a vital connection for all roadway users within San Diego’s communities of City Heights, El Cerrito, Rolando Park, and Rolando Village, and the City of La Mesa.
The project includes 2.8 miles of separated and buffered bike lanes, bus islands, bold and reflective crosswalks, a protected intersection at 54th Street and University Avenue, and other improvements designed to improve travel and safety for all roadway users. In addition, SANDAG is partnering with the City of San Diego to complete pavement resurfacing and pothole repairs along University Avenue in the project area.
Before construction started, SANDAG engaged local businesses, residents, schools, and community groups to incorporate feedback on the project during the planning, environmental, and design phases.
Schedule
We started construction in March 2026 and expect to complete it in late 2027. SANDAG will manage construction and the City of San Diego will own and operate the bikeway upon completion.
The bikeway on University Avenue will connect to several other bikeways, including the bikeway that is part of the Orange Avenue Complete Streets project (under construction, one of six segments planned as part of the North Park | Mid-City Complete Streets project), another that is part of the Central Avenue Complete Streets project (also under construction), and other bikeways in the cities of San Diego and La Mesa.
